The geometry of Ni(CO)₄ and Ni(PPh₃)₂Cl₂ are

Options

(a) both square planar
(b) tetrahedral and square planar respectively
(c) both tetrahedral
(d) square planar and tetrahedral respectively

Correct Answer:

both tetrahedral
